Prep Time: 20 Minutes Cook Time: 15 Minutes |
Ready In: 35 Minutes Servings: 6 |
|
Recipe courtesy of Louis Kemp Seafood Co. . I'm a sucker for easy food that tastes good too, so this recipe seems to be right up my alley. I have NOT tried this recipe, so feel free to add suggestions... Ingredients:
8 ounces imitation crabmeat, diced |
1/4 cup cajun marinade (or use a liberal amount of dry cajun seasoning) |
1 tablespoon oil |
1 cup onion, chopped |
1/2 red bell pepper, chopped |
1/2 green bell pepper, chopped |
1 small tomato, diced |
1/8 teaspoon red pepper (optional) |
1 cup instant rice |
1 cup water |
Directions:
1. In a large skillet, heat oil to medium high. 2. Add onions and peppers and cook for 5 minutes until tender. 3. Stir in all other ingredients and bring to a boil. 4. Cover and remove from heat, let stand 5 minutes. |
